Leaking pipe repair services involve identifying and fixing pipes that are leaking or showing signs of deterioration. This process typically begins with a thorough inspection to locate the source of the leak, which may be hidden behind walls, beneath floors, or underground. Once the problem area is pinpointed, contractors use specialized tools and techniques to repair or replace the affected pipe sections. The goal is to stop the leak, prevent further water damage, and restore the integrity of the plumbing system efficiently and effectively.

These services help address a variety of plumbing problems, including persistent water leaks, low water pressure, or visible signs of water damage such as staining, mold, or musty odors. Leaking pipes can lead to significant issues if left unaddressed, including structural damage to the property, increased water bills, and potential health risks from mold growth. Repairing leaking pipes promptly can save homeowners from costly repairs down the line and help maintain a safe, dry, and functional living environment.

The overview below groups typical Leaking Pipe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$250-$600 for many routine leak repairs in accessible pipes. Most small jobs fall within this middle range, depending on pipe location and damage severity.

Moderate Fixes - more involved repairs, such as replacing sections of pipe or fixing hidden leaks, usually cost between $600-$1,500. Larger, more complex projects are less common but can reach higher prices.

Full Pipe Replacement - replacing an entire section or the whole pipe system often costs from $2,000 to $5,000 or more, especially in older or extensive plumbing setups. Many projects fall into the lower to mid part of this range.

Complex or Emergency Repairs - urgent or extensive repairs, including accessing hard-to-reach pipes or dealing with significant water damage, can exceed $5,000. Such cases are less frequent but represent the higher end of typical cost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How do I know if I have a leaking pipe? Signs of a leaking pipe include unexplained water bills, water stains on walls or ceilings, and the presence of mold or musty odors near plumbing fixtures. A professional inspection can confirm if a leak is present.

What are common causes of pipe leaks? Pipe leaks can result from corrosion, high water pressure, frozen pipes, or physical damage. Regular maintenance and inspections can help identify potential issues early.

Can local contractors repair leaks in any type of pipe? Many service providers are experienced in repairing various types of pipes, including copper, PVC, and galvanized steel, ensuring proper fixes regardless of pipe material.

What methods do professionals use to repair leaking pipes? Repair methods may include pipe patching, replacing damaged sections, or using epoxy sealants. The appropriate approach depends on the pipe's location and extent of damage.

How can I prevent future pipe leaks? Regular inspections, maintaining proper water pressure, and insulating pipes in colder months can help reduce the risk of leaks and water damage.
